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ia
Conditions
Brief summary
The purpose of this open-label, multicenter, randomized, Phase III study is to evaluate the benefit of venetoclax in combination with rituximab compared with bendamustine in combination with rituximab in participants with relapsed or refractory CLL. Participants will be randomly assigned in 1:1 ratio to receive either venetoclax + rituximab (Arm A) or bendamustine + rituximab (Arm B).
Interventions
Bendamustine will be administered at a dose of 70 mg/m\^2 via IV infusion on Days 1 and 2 of each 28-day cycle, for 6 cycles.
Venetoclax will be administered at an initial dose of 20 mg via tablet orally QD, incremented weekly up to a maximum dose of 400 mg during a 5-week ramp-up period. Venetoclax will be continued at 400 mg QD from Week 6 (Day 1 of Cycle 1 of combination therapy) onwards up to disease progression (PD) or 2 years, whichever occurs first. R/C Substudy: venetoclax will be administered for 5-week dose ramp-up period to reach the target dose of 400 mg QD. Venetoclax will continue to be administered during the rituximab cycles until disease progression or for a maximum of 2 years from Cycle 1R/C Day 1 of the R/C Substudy.
Rituximab will be administered at a dose of 375 mg/m\^2 via IV infusion on Day 1 of Cycle 1 and at a dose of 500 mg/m\^2 on Day 1 of Cycles 2-6. R/C Substudy: Following the venetoclax ramp-up period, rituximab will be administered for 6 cycles consisting of a single infusion on the first day of each 28-day cycle.

Participant flow
Recruitment details
A total 389 participants took part in the study across 109 investigative sites in 20 countries i.e., Korea, Taiwan, Australia, New Zealand, Czech Republic, Hungary, Poland, Russia, Canada, United States of America, Austria, Belgium, Germany, Denmark, Spain, France, United Kingdom, Italy, Netherlands and Sweden from 17 March 2014 to 03 August 2022. The trial consisted of a main study and an optional Retreatment/Crossover (R/C) sub study.
Pre-assignment details
Of the 389 participants enrolled 7 participants in the bendamustine + rituximab (BR) arm did not receive a valid dose of study treatment.

Outcome results
Percentage of Participants With PD as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ard International Workshop on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(iwCLL) Guidelines or Death
Assessment of response was performed by the investigator according to the iwCLL guidelines. PD was defined as occurrence of one of the following events: appearance of any new extra nodal lesion; new palpable lymph node (greater than \[\>\] 1.5 centimeters \[cm\]); unequivocal progression of non-target lesion; an increase of greater than or equal to (\>/=) 50 percent (%) compared to baseline in splenomegaly, hepatomegaly, number of blood lymphocytes with lymphocyte count \>/=5000 per microliter (mcL), or in longest diameter of any extra nodal lesion; transformation to a more aggressive histology; decrease of \>/=50% compared to baseline in platelet or neutrophil count; or decrease in hemoglobin level by \>2 grams per deciliter (g/dL) or to less than \[\<\] 10 g/dL. Percentages are rounded off.
Time frame: Baseline up to PD or death from any cause, whichever occurred first (up to approximately 8 years 5 months)
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(NUMBER)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With PD as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ard International Workshop on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(iwCLL) Guidelines or Death | 88.7 percentage of participants |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With PD as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ard International Workshop on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(iwCLL) Guidelines or Death | 70.1 percentage of participants |
Progression-Free Survival (PF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ard iwCLL Guidelines
PFS was defined as the time from randomization until first occurrence of PD/relapse as assessed by the investigator using iwCLL guidelines, or death from any cause, whichever occurred first. PD: occurrence of one of the following: new lesion; new palpable lymph node (\>1.5 cm); unequivocal progression of non-target lesion; increase of \>/=50% in splenomegaly, hepatomegaly, blood lymphocytes with count \>/=5000/mcL, longest diameter of any lesion; transformation to more aggressive histology; decrease of \>/=50% in platelet or neutrophil count, or hemoglobin level by \>2 g/dL or to \<10 g/dL. Participants who had not progressed, relapsed, or died at the time of analysis, were censored on the date of last assessment. In case of no disease assessment after baseline, PFS was censored at the time of randomization+1 day. The median PFS was estimated using Kaplan-Meier method and the 95% confidence interval (CI) was computed using method of Brookmeyer and Crowley.
Time frame: Baseline up to PD or death, whichever occurred first (up to approximately 8 years 5 months)
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(MEDIAN)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Progression-Free Survival (PF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ard iwCLL Guidelines | 17.0 months |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Progression-Free Survival (PF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using Standard iwCLL Guidelines | 54.7 months |

Duration of Responses (DOR)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ines
DOR was defined as the time from first occurrence of a documented response of CR, CRi, nPR, or PR until PD/relapse, as assessed by the investigator according to the iwCLL guidelines, or death from any cause. PD: occurrence of one of the following: new lesion; new palpable lymph node (\>1.5 cm); unequivocal progression of non-target lesion; increase of \>/=50% in splenomegaly, hepatomegaly, blood lymphocytes with count \>/=5000/mcL, longest diameter of any lesion; transformation to more aggressive histology; decrease of \>/=50% in platelet or neutrophil count, or hemoglobin level by \>2 g/dL or to \<10 g/dL. Participants without PD or death after response were censored at the last date of adequate response assessment. The median DOR was estimated using Kaplan-Meier method and the 95% CI was computed using method of Brookmeyer and Crowley. CR, CRi, nPR, and PR have been defined in previous outcomes, and are not repeated here due to space constraint.
Time frame: From time of achieving best overall response until PD or death from any cause, whichever occurred first (up to approximately 8 years 5 months)
Population: Analysis was performed on ITT population participants who had best overall response of CR, CRi, nPR, or PR.
| Arm | Measure | Value (MEDIAN)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Duration of Responses (DOR)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ines | 19.1 months |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Duration of Responses (DOR)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ines | 53.6 months |
Event-Free Survival (EF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ines
EFS was defined as the time from date of randomization until the date of PD/relapse, start of a new non-protocol-specified anti-CLL therapy, or death from any cause, whichever occurred first, as assessed by the investigator. PD: occurrence of one of the following: new lesion; new palpable lymph node (\>1.5 cm); unequivocal progression of non-target lesion; increase of \>/=50% in splenomegaly, hepatomegaly, blood lymphocytes with count \>/=5000/mcL, longest diameter of any lesion; transformation to more aggressive histology; decrease of \>/=50% in platelet or neutrophil count, or hemoglobin level by \>2 g/dL or to \<10 g/dL. Participants without any of the specified event at the time of analysis were censored at the date of last adequate response assessment. In case of no post-baseline response assessment, participants were censored at the randomization date. The median EFS was estimated using Kaplan-Meier method and the 95% CI was computed using method of Brookmeyer and Crowley.
Time frame: Baseline up to PD/relapse, start of a new anti-CLL therapy, or death from any cause, whichever occurred first (approximately 8 years 5 months)
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(MEDIAN)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Event-Free Survival (EF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ines | 16.4 months |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Event-Free Survival (EFS) as Assessed by the Investigator Using iwCLL Guidelines | 53.7 months |

Overall Survival (OS)
OS was defined as the time from the date of randomization to the date of death from any cause. Participants alive at the time of the analysis were censored at the date when they were last known to be alive as documented by the investigator. The median OS was estimated using Kaplan-Meier method and the 95% CI was computed using method of Brookmeyer and Crowley.
Time frame: Baseline up to approximately 8 years 5 months
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(MEDIAN)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Overall Survival (OS) | 87.8 months |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Overall Survival (OS) | NA months |
Percentage of Participants Who Died
Percentage of participants who died from any cause, during the study, was reported. Percentage is rounded off.
Time frame: Baseline up to approximately 8 years 5 months
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(NUMBER)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ants Who Died | 43.1 percentage of participants |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ants Who Died | 30.9 percentage of participants |

Percentage of Participants With Minimal Residual Disease (MRD) Negativity in Peripheral Blood
MRD-negativity was defined as the presence of \<1 malignant B-cell per 10000 normal B-cells in a sample of at least 200000 B-cells, as assessed by the allele specific oligonucleotide polymerase chain reaction (ASO-PCR) and/or flow cytometry technique. Percentage of participants with MRD-negativity was reported. The 95% CI was computed using Pearson-Clopper method. Percentage is rounded off.
Time frame: EoCTR visit (8 to 12 weeks after C6D1); Cycle length = 28 days
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(NUMBER)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With Minimal Residual Disease (MRD) Negativity in Peripheral Blood | 13.3 percentage of participants |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With Minimal Residual Disease (MRD) Negativity in Peripheral Blood | 62.4 percentage of participants |
Percentage of Participants With MRD Negativity in Bone Marrow
MRD-negativity was defined as the presence of \<1 malignant B-cell per 10000 normal B-cells in a sample of at least 200000 B-cells, as assessed flow cytometry technique. Percentage of participants with MRD-negativity was reported. The 95% CI was computed using Pearson-Clopper method. Percentages are rounded off.
Time frame: EoCTR visit (8 to 12 weeks after C6D1); Cycle length = 28 days
Population: ITT population included all randomized participants, with participants grouped according to randomized treatment group, regardless of the actual treatment received.
| Arm | Measure | Value (NUMBER) |
|---|---|---|
| Bendamustine +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With MRD Negativity in Bone Marrow | 1.0 percentage of participants |
| Venetoclax + Rituximab Main Study | Percentage of Participants With MRD Negativity in Bone Marrow | 14.4 percentage of participants |
